Early Career
Igarashi’s journey in boxing began with an impressive amateur career. He amassed a record of 60 wins and 6 losses as an amateur, showcasing his natural talent and dedication to the sport.
This strong foundation set the stage for his transition to professional boxing, where he would continue to hone his skills and make a name for himself.
Professional Career
Turning professional in 2008, Igarashi quickly established himself as a promising talent in the Japanese boxing scene.
His career has been marked by significant achievements, including holding the IBF super-bantamweight title from 2017 to 2018 and the interim version from 2019 to April 2021.
Igarashi’s fighting style is characterized by his southpaw stance, which often gives him an advantage over orthodox fighters.
He’s known for his technical skills, quick footwork, and ability to adapt his strategy mid-fight.
